fantasai has just created a new issue for https://github.com/w3c/csswg-drafts: == [css-ruby-1] Rename ruby-merge: collapse to ruby-merge: merge == From @r12a ``` http://www.w3.org/TR/css-ruby-1/#collapsed-ruby 4.2 Sharing Annotation Space: the ruby-merge property If the ruby-merge property is to remain, i think that a better name for the `collapse` value would be `merge`, ie. ruby-merge: merge; The meaning of `collapse` is not as obvious as `merge`, to my mind. ``` Please view or discuss this issue at https://github.com/w3c/csswg-drafts/issues/5004 using your GitHub account
